|
|
|
|
- Presentación
- Ejemplos de aplicación
¿Cómo utilizar los operadores indirectos?
Los operadores indirectos ( { }) se utilizan para manipular un objeto cuyo nombre se encuentra en un Variable. Esto permite construir mediante programación el nombre del objeto que se utilizará en una Variable y luego aplicar acciones para conocer o modificar las características de este objeto. La sintaxis es la siguiente: { VariableName, ObjectType }..PropertyName donde: - Variable Nombre es una cadena Variable que contiene el nombre del objeto a utilizar.
- ObjectType es una constante de indXXX que representa el tipo de objeto a utilizar (control, Variable, ventana, etc.).
ControlName is string ControlName = "EDT_NAME" // Change the background color of control whose name is EDT_NAME {ControlName, indControl}..BackgroundColor = LightRed
// Clear the TEXT edit controls in a window nIndex is int = 1 sControlName is string sControlName = EnumControl(WIN_Table, nIndex) WHILE sControlName<>"" IF {sControlName, indControl}..Type = typText THEN {sControlName, indControl} = "" END nSub++ sControlName = EnumControl(WIN_Table, nIndex) END
Esta página también está disponible para…
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|